I preordered the Stingray version, and I'm also pretty pumped. I got a chance to talk to Steve Moore a few times when he'd come to town for film fest related things. Apparently, the last Zombi album was more guitar heavy in a way that was inspired by his recent work on the Bliss and VFW soundtracks. Very 80s horror theme-ish, kinda minimal.

I also have this thing on the way (below) - it should be arriving any day and I'm very psyched for it since it's in the vein of old KPM style synth heavy library music of the 70's. He also put out a pretty great Halloween record called "The Haunted Library" for Amazon a couple years ago (Hospital Records also had one as well) which also had a library music vibe.
